(Quite) A Few Words About Maths:
Over the next few weeks Primary 5, 6 and 7 are going to be trialling resources created by White Rose Maths. This resource is used in many schools across the country and is particularly useful at this time as it can be easily accessed online and provides teaching videos as well as practise activities.
Each week, we will choose a focus for you from the website. Initially these will focus on revising topics already covered. White Rose Maths is based around the English Year system which progresses differently to the Scottish Curriculum for Excellence, so please don’t worry if the lessons are jumping around within the White Rose website or we’re giving you lessons from different years (e.g. P6 may be given activities from Year 4 or 5).
Each lesson on the site is intended to take 20-30 minutes and has a teaching video and a worksheet. You don’t need to print the worksheet off, you can just write the answers down in your jotter and check them at the end.Don’t worry if you get stuck on some of the Flashback 4 questions as we may not have covered them.
